#2b5f5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b5f5e is composed of 16.9% red, 37.3%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 178.8 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 27.1%. #2b5f5e color hex could be obtained by blending #56bebc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#2b5f5e color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#2b5f5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b5f5e has RGB values of R:43, G:95,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 2842462.
